Doug Braase, M.A., is a registered counseling intern dedicated to helping individuals and couples navigate life’s challenges with clarity, resilience, and purpose. He earned his Master’s degree in Clinical Mental Health Counseling from Liberty University and also holds a diploma in Mental Health Coaching from Light University, further equipping him to support clients in both clinical and goal-oriented settings.
He has experience working with a diverse range of clients and has a strong interest in treating anxiety, trauma, grief, and life transitions. Doug is a Navy Veteran and is especially passionate about supporting veterans and their families, helping them process experiences and successfully adjust to life beyond military service.
He is also a certified SYMBIS (Saving Your Marriage Before It Starts) Facilitator and enjoys working with couples in both premarital and relationship enrichment settings. Through this framework, Doug helps couples build strong foundations, improve communication, and develop lasting, healthy relationships through biblical principles.
His counseling approach is integrative and client-centered, drawing from evidence-based practices while tailoring each session to the individual’s unique needs. Doug is committed to creating a safe, supportive, and nonjudgmental environment where clients feel heard, understood, and empowered to grow.
He has a particular future interest in trauma-focused therapies, including EMDR and Accelerated Resolution Therapy (ART), and is committed to ongoing professional development in these areas.
